Comparing Rods and Pistons for 2g Eclipse: Which Brands Offer the Best Power Handling for 300+ Hp

The 2G Eclipse, known for its tuning potential and performance capabilities, often sees modifications aimed at increasing horsepower. When pushing the limits beyond 300 hp, selecting the right rods and pistons becomes crucial. This article explores various brands and their offerings for rods and pistons that can handle high power outputs effectively.

Understanding Rods and Pistons

Before diving into brand comparisons, it’s important to grasp the roles of rods and pistons in an engine. Connecting rods link the pistons to the crankshaft, while pistons are responsible for compressing the air-fuel mixture for combustion. Both components must withstand significant stress and heat when operating at higher horsepower levels.

Key Factors in Choosing Rods and Pistons

  • Material: Common materials include forged steel, aluminum, and billet options.
  • Weight: Lighter components can improve engine response and efficiency.
  • Durability: High-performance parts must withstand extreme conditions.
  • Compatibility: Ensure parts fit properly with existing engine components.

Top Brands for Rods

Eagle Specialty Products

Eagle is well-known for producing high-quality forged connecting rods. Their products are designed to handle high horsepower applications, making them a popular choice among tuners. The Eagle rods are lightweight yet robust, providing excellent performance.

Manley Performance

Manley rods are engineered for extreme strength and reliability. They offer a range of options suitable for high-power builds, focusing on precision and durability. Manley rods are often favored for their performance in racing applications.

Carillo

Carillo is synonymous with high-performance connecting rods. Their products are crafted using advanced materials and technology, ensuring they can handle the stresses of high horsepower applications effectively. Carillo rods are a premium option for serious enthusiasts.

Top Brands for Pistons

CP-Carrillo

CP-Carrillo pistons are designed for high-performance applications, providing excellent strength and lightweight properties. Their pistons are customizable, allowing tuners to select specifications that match their engine setup.

<h3Wiseco

Wiseco is a trusted name in the piston industry, known for its forged pistons that offer superior strength and performance. Their products are designed to withstand the rigors of high horsepower applications, making them a favorite among tuners.

Diamond Pistons

Diamond Pistons specializes in high-performance forged pistons that cater to various racing applications. Their commitment to quality and performance makes them a reliable choice for those looking to push their 2G Eclipse beyond 300 hp.
